Transaction 623a7112b0d7e6302ce7137fa34d7973604659193e95a2027dce983f39833964

1 Input
2 Outputs
  • 623a7112b0d7e6302ce7137fa34d7973604659193e95a2027dce983f39833964:0
  • value  1050313
    address  2NEiWFNYufir1pYJiTHX85dZyb9swU72uKd
  • 623a7112b0d7e6302ce7137fa34d7973604659193e95a2027dce983f39833964:1
  • value  9992053507
    address  2NAd1HPfjMkrP9Q8nKPVWhJaRTddjtmcBsf